Milan Momcilovic is the best 3-point shooter in men's college basketball, boasting a 49.3% accuracy rate.
He uses the word "jellybean" as a mental trigger before shooting to focus and eliminate doubts.
Momcilovic's improved confidence and consistency have significantly contributed to Iowa State's success.
NBA scouts are eyeing Momcilovic, with the Milwaukee Bucks potentially interested in drafting the Wisconsin native.
Why this matters: Momcilovic's success highlights the importance of mental preparation in sports. His unique approach and impressive stats make him a player to watch in college basketball and a potential NBA prospect.
Milan Momcilovic's journey to becoming a top college basketball player involves overcoming early struggles and refining his mental game. Working with a sports psychologist, he developed the "jellybean" technique to enhance focus and consistency.
Momcilovic's exceptional shooting ability has transformed Iowa State's offense. His high 3-point percentage and overall offensive efficiency make him a threat to opponents. His mental approach is particularly notable, demonstrating the power of psychological techniques in sports.
As a Wisconsin native, Momcilovic has garnered attention from the Milwaukee Bucks. His shooting prowess and developing all-around game make him an attractive prospect for teams seeking versatile players. The Bucks may need to trade to acquire a suitable draft pick to secure him.
While Momcilovic gets a lot of attention, freshman guard Kyllian Toure is also vital for Iowa State. His defensive skills and ability to disrupt opponents' stars is a key component of the Cyclones' success. If Iowa State makes a deep tournament run, Toure's performance on both ends of the court will be a major factor.
